Display Comparison
The Nokia T20 boasts a significant advantage here. Its 422 nits of brightness and 1786:1 contrast ratio provide a noticeably more vibrant and enjoyable viewing experience compared to the TCL Tab 10 HD 4G, which lacks specific brightness or contrast specifications but is generally considered less impressive. Colors are more accurate and blacks are deeper on the Nokia.

Performance
The Nokia T20's Unisoc T610 chipset, built on a 12nm process, offers a more modern architecture and generally better performance than the TCL's Mediatek MT8768E. The Nokia's Cortex-A75 cores provide a boost for demanding tasks, while the TCL relies on older Cortex-A53 cores. Expect smoother multitasking and app loading on the Nokia.
